⚙️ Why Teach Tradeoff Mapping?
Tradeoffs are a fundamental part of science, engineering, technology, and everyday life. Whether designing a bridge, conserving water resources, selecting materials, or improving transportation systems, students must learn that there is rarely a perfect solution. This worksheet helps learners understand that effective decisions often involve balancing competing goals while considering costs, benefits, risks, sustainability, and performance.
